Does ENaC Work as Sodium Taste Receptor in Humans?
Taste reception is fundamental for the proper selection of food and beverages. Among the several chemicals recognized by the human taste system, sodium ions (Na(+)) are of particular relevance. Na(+) represents the main extracellular cation and is a key factor in many physiological processes. Na(+)...
